Whenever you think that the Google Maps camera can't surprise you anymore it unveils yet more funny and bizarre human behaviour. This time it's Norilsk in Russia and four Teletubbies that have gone viral, after being captured by the camera car.

Evidently a fan of following the Google car around, four people wandering the streets of Norilsk in northern Russia have repeatedly been snapped dressed in colour-coded boiler suits that look an awful lot like Teletubby costumes.

The image also pans around to reveal that the eerie quartet are all wearing matching face masks too. They have clearly been saying eh-oh to the Google Maps car quite a bit as well, having been snapped in their outfits in dozens of images taken by the vehicle.

The group just happen to be in the right place at the right time, multiple times, or they know exactly where Google are headed and have been following them round. If you live north of the Arctic Circle in an isolated city you've got to get your kicks somehow.

It has been speculated that the four might in fact be Google employees, with one Reddit commenter saying: "Looks like the Google Maps street crew, since it's cold they are wearing the boiler suits."

That would make sense, given that their colours of yellow, green, red and purple do match the brightly coloured aesthetic of the Google brand.

Another theory is that they might be pranksters having a laugh. "This looks like one hell of a drunken walk," wrote one commenter.
